Spark plugs - General Information



general description

Candle for transferring high voltage generated by the ignition coil, lowered to the electrodes in the combustion chamber, wherein the current produces a spark that provides ignition of the working mixture.

Inside the combustion chamber spark subjected to cyclic thermal and barometric effects, moreover, are not the last role played by the climatic factor.

One of the main requirements for the spark plug is its operation at a voltage above 30 kV and the ability to resist the destruction of its insulation when subjected to temperatures up to 1000 ?� C. In addition, into the combustion chamber of the candle must have good resistance to high-temperature corrosion.

Another important parameter to ensure proper functioning of the spark plug is its heat-removing ability. Since candle undergoes rapid periodic changes in temperature determined by its alternate contact is supplied with the cylinder working with a mixture of cold, then warm up to enormous temperature combustion, its ceramic insulator should be highly resistant to cyclic thermal loads.

The recommended type of spark plugs is determined by, among other things heat range, characterized by the ability to resist thermal stresses candles. Thus, the higher the heat rating, the lower the temperature characteristic of the candle.

Temperature characteristics of spark plugs

1 - Low heat rating (hot plug)
2 - The average heat rating
3 - High heat rating (cold candle)

Proper selection of the number of candles on the mantle prevents misfiring as the warm-up time of the engine, and in the state mode of operation. In addition to increasing the stability of the engine speed and improve the performance of its economy to prevent misfire can significantly reduce the concentration of the emission of hydrocarbons (HC).

Stability and intensity of sparking candle is determined by its electrode gap. At first glance it is preferable to have a maximum clearance between the central and side electrodes of the plug, as increasing the size of the spark provides reliable combustion air-fuel mixture by increasing the volume of its initial ignition. On the other hand, the excessive size of the gap increases the likelihood that the coil produced by the breakdown voltage is not sufficient to obtain a stable spark discharge under adverse circumstances, especially at the end of the life of the candle.

In modern engines, a high degree of compression ignition for sustainable exceptions Misfire richness for the life of the candle should be particularly attentive to the observance of the normalized electrode gap.

In appearance, the candle can be concluded about the candle, quality management and the mixture state of the engine (pistons, piston rings, etc.).

Coal deposits

Symptoms: The presence of soot indicates pereobogaschenie air-fuel mixture or low intensity spark. It causes misfiring complicates start and leads to instability of the engine.
Recommendation: Check whether the air cleaner is not blocked is not too high fuel level in the float chamber, if not jammed choke and not too worn contacts. Try to use candles with longer insulator that raises resistance to contamination.

Oiling

Symptoms: oily contamination spark causes wear stem seals. The oil enters the combustion chamber through the valve guides or worn piston ring. It causes misfiring complicates start and leads to instability of the engine.
Recommendation: Perform mechanical recovery work and replace candles.

Overheat

Symptoms: Porous, white insulator, erosion of electrodes and the absence of any deposits. It leads to a reduction in the life of the candle.
Recommendation: Check whether the requirements of Specifications of the Head of System of an electric motor heat rating established candles, correctly exposed ignition timing is not served there too lean air-fuel mixture leaks vacuum inlet pipeline and whether valves are jammed. Check the coolant level as well, and blockage in the radiator.

Too early ignition

Symptoms: Electrodes are melted. The insulator is white, but may be contaminated due to a misfire, or falling into the combustion chamber of foreign particles. It may lead to engine damage.
Recommendation: Check the number of installed glow of candles, the ignition timing, the quality of the mixture (not too depleted), blockage in the cooling system is functioning normally and the lubrication system.

Electrically conductive gloss

Symptoms: Insulator has yellowish color and the polished look. It speaks about sudden rise in temperature in the combustion chambers at sharp acceleration. Ordinary deposits while melted, getting kind of lacquer. It leads to misfire at high speeds.
Recommendations: Change candles (colder, while maintaining the driving style).

The closure of the electrodes

Symptoms: Waste combustion products enter the inter-electrode space. Solid deposits accumulate, forming a bridge between the electrodes. Leads to failure of the ignition cylinder.
Recommendation: Remove deposits from the electrode area.

The normal state of candles

Symptoms: Gray-brown color and easy deterioration of electrodes. Heat range spark for the type of engine and its general condition.
Recommendations: At replacement of candles set the candles of the same type.

Peploobrazovanie

Symptoms: Soft brownish deposits on one or both of the spark plug electrodes. The source of their formation are applied additives to oil and / or fuel. Excessive accumulation can lead to isolation of the electrodes and cause misfiring and unstable engine performance during acceleration.
Recommendation: With the rapid accumulation of sediment change stem seals that will prevent oil from entering the combustion chamber. Try to change the brand of fuel.

Wear

Symptoms: Rounding electrodes with a small accumulation of deposits on the working end. Color normal. It leads to difficulty starting the engine in cold damp weather and increased fuel consumption.
Recommendations: Change candles on new, the same type.

Detonation

Symptoms: Insulators can be cleaved or cracked. It can cause damage to the insulator as sloppy technique adjustment of a candle backlash. It can cause damage to the pistons.

Splashing

Symptoms: After misfire for a long period of time deposits can disintegrating maintaining the operating temperature in the combustion chamber. At high speeds of deposition flakes come off the piston and stick to a hot insulator, causing misfiring.
Recommendations: Replace candles or smooth out and replace the old ones.

Mechanical damage

Symptoms may be caused by the ingress of foreign material into the combustion chamber, or occur when the piston stroke about too long candle. Lead to refusal of functioning of the cylinder and piston damage.
Recommendation: Remove from the engine extraneous particles and / or replace sveyai.

When screwing the candles do not exceed specified in the Specifications of the Head of System of an electric motor maximum permissible tightening force.
